Cocomalt Recipes
Description:
The front reads, "The recipes in this little folder are the most popular Cocomalt recipes originated and collected. They illustrate how Cocomalt, the Iron rich tonic in food form, can be used in many ways in addition to serving it as a delicious beverage." The front is orange, white, and black. The back reads, "Cocomalt, Recommended for New Vitality, Convalescents, Nursing Mothers, Elderly People, and Growing Children. Rich in Iron, Vitamin D, Calcium, and Phosphorus." A can of Cocomalt is on the back. An orange frame surrounds the back lettering. Orange bulls' eyes.
